Lines Matching defs:mii
74 #include <dev/mii/mii.h>
75 #include <dev/mii/miivar.h>
76 #include <dev/mii/miidevs.h>
78 #include <dev/mii/ikphyreg.h>
115 struct mii_data *mii = ma->mii_data;
123 sc->mii_inst = mii->mii_instance;
129 sc->mii_pdata = mii;
132 mii_lock(mii);
141 mii_unlock(mii);
147 ikphy_service(struct mii_softc *sc, struct mii_data *mii, int cmd)
149 struct ifmedia_entry *ife = mii->mii_media.ifm_cur;
152 KASSERT(mii_locked(mii));
173 if ((mii->mii_ifp->if_flags & IFF_UP) == 0)
205 struct mii_data *mii = sc->mii_pdata;
206 struct ifmedia_entry *ife = mii->mii_media.ifm_cur;
208 KASSERT(mii_locked(mii));
283 struct mii_data *mii = sc->mii_pdata;
284 struct ifmedia_entry *ife = mii->mii_media.ifm_cur;
287 KASSERT(mii_locked(mii));
289 mii->mii_media_status = IFM_AVALID;
290 mii->mii_media_active = IFM_ETHER;
295 mii->mii_media_status |= IFM_ACTIVE;
299 mii->mii_media_active |= IFM_NONE;
300 mii->mii_media_status = 0;
305 mii->mii_media_active |= IFM_LOOP;
314 mii->mii_media_active |= IFM_NONE;
320 mii->mii_media_active |= IFM_1000_T;
323 mii->mii_media_active |= IFM_ETH_MASTER;
327 mii->mii_media_active |= IFM_100_TX;
331 mii->mii_media_active |= IFM_10_T;
335 mii->mii_media_active |= IFM_NONE;
336 mii->mii_media_status = 0;
341 mii->mii_media_active |=
344 mii->mii_media_active |= IFM_HDX;
346 mii->mii_media_active = ife->ifm_media;
348 if (mii->mii_media_active & IFM_FDX)